>> +    if (of_id) {
>> +        int len = 0;
>> +
>> +        if (of_get_property(dev->of_node, "renesas,usb0-hs", &len))
>> +            priv->ugctrl2 = USBHS_UGCTRL2_USB0_HS;
>> +        else
>> +            priv->ugctrl2 = USBHS_UGCTRL2_USB0_PCI;
>> +
>> +        if (of_get_property(dev->of_node, "renesas,usb2-ss", &len))
>
>     You can use of_property_read_bool() in both cases as both these
> props are boolean I guess. It's more handy.

Thanks, missed that one, will sort that out.
